Meditation Moment #282 features a haunting quote from Simon Wiesenthal (December 31, 1908 – September 20, 2005), a Jewish Austrian Holocaust survivor, N**i hunter, and writer who played a role in the capture of Adolf Eichmann. This is, without a doubt, the darkest of all the meditations I’ve done. It took me quite some time to find the right accompaniment, and when I finally did, I was grateful to have Cameron’s brother, Damon, there to help bring it to life.
